Exploring Christian Prayer Traditions and Practices
Christian believers have established a rich array of prayer practices over centuries . These vary considerably across denominations , from the liturgical prayers of the Catholic Church and Eastern traditions, to the more spontaneous approaches found in Reformed Christianity. Usual forms include rote prayers like the Lord's Prayer, contemplative disciplines such as lectio divina , and petitionary prayer for those in need. Exploring these varied methods reveals a profound longing for communion with our Creator.
